Laripur® 6560 is a TPU based on PTMG polyether, known for its exceptional resistance to hydrolysis and microbial attacks. This standard version is primarily designed for applications like injection molding, making it an ideal choice for producing items such as ski boots and technical components. Its robust properties ensure durability in demanding manufacturing processes.

Processing Recommendations

Material needs to be dried prior processing at 175-195 °F for 3 hours, preferably using a dehumidifying drier fed by air exhibiting a dew point lower than -22°F.
Suggested molding temperature profile

Zone Temperature
Zone 1 395°F
Zone 2 405°F
Zone 3 415°F
Nozzle 405°F

 

Being affected by type of machine used, processing conditions and downstream equipment, the temperature profiles as given above has to be considered as just indicative.

Packaging Information

Laripur® 6560 is supplied in regular pellet form and it is packaged in 25 kg bags or 500 kg and 1000 kg octabins.

Storage and Shelf Life Conditions
  • Laripur® 6560 must be stored in its original and sealed containers and kept in a dry and well ventilated place; avoiding the direct sun radiation.
  • The shelf life of Laripur® 6560 will be 6 months from the date of delivery to the final customer, when stored in its original sealed packaging and in proper conditions.
